659746-83-5,86384-21-6,91918-61-5,890764-22-4,890764-34-8,890764-50-8 Supplier | SACCHARIDE.IN
CMO CDMO service. SACCHARIDE.IN supply 659746-83-5,86384-21-6,91918-61-5,890764-22-4,890764-34-8,890764-50-8 and related compounds.
890764-50-8 659746-83-5 86384-21-6 890764-34-8 890764-22-4 91918-61-5